Average Nurse Practitioners Salary in Monroe, LA
Nurse Practitioners in Monroe, LA, earn an average annual salary of $122,100. This figure is slightly below the national average of $131,710, suggesting that while demand is present, local economic factors and potentially a different healthcare landscape contribute to this compensation. The specific pay rates are often influenced by the unique needs and economic conditions of the region.
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$122,100 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 14.9% ↗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$155,990.
- Outlook: With a total local workforce of 270 Nurse Practitioners, Monroe, LA, demonstrates a stable, albeit not massive, presence of these essential healthcare professionals. The Location Quotient of 1.55 indicates a concentration of Nurse Practitioners that is 55% higher than the national average, signaling a robust demand and a significant role for these practitioners within the local healthcare ecosystem.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 270 employees in the Monroe, LA area with a job density of 3.089 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
